Position Description

You will serve as an Aviation/Ship Integration Assistant Program Manager for Systems Engineering (APMSE) supporting PMA-251 Aircraft Launch and Recovery Equipment Program Office of NAVAIRWARCENAC DIV. You will support the PMA-251 Chief Engineer. You will lead and manage engineering and technical efforts for bridging the interface to integrate PMA-251 products and aviation systems with shipboard systems, facilities, or both.

Position Duties/Responsibilities

  • You will develop and review program technical and mission documentation, providing authoritative input and advice on all engineering and technical issues and ensuring engineering requirements are met.
  • You will participate in the development and design of new systems by assessing if available or imminent technology is sufficient to meet requirements or system concepts are applicable to fleet operational requirements.
  • You will formulate engineering design concepts and performance requirements which provide the basis for overall technical and engineering planning for the assigned system.
  • You will maintain knowledge of current arid future capabilities, problems and demands upon the system(s) and provide overall technical planning for development, engineering, and evaluation of programs.
  • You will integrate cost estimates with program plans (schedules, development requirements), test and evaluation requirements, projected problems, etc.,) into a total acquisition POM and budget.
  • You will evaluate technological developments and their applicability to the assigned program, and recommend appropriate technical changes throughout the design process.
  • You will assess progress of system development test and evaluation activities, inventory, production, and support; to ensure adequate resources for project execution.
